Window Crack Repair: A Comprehensive Guide

Windows are more than simply openings in a building; they are necessary for natural light, ventilation, and energy efficiency. Nevertheless, they are also vulnerable to damage, specifically from cracks. While small cracks may appear harmless, they can rapidly escalate into major concerns if left unaddressed. This thorough guide explores the steps and factors to consider associated with fixing window cracks, offering house owners with the understanding to preserve the stability of their windows.

Comprehending Window Cracks

Window fractures can take place due to various reasons, consisting of:

  • Temperature Fluctuations: Extreme modifications in temperature can cause glass to expand and agreement, causing stress fractures.
  • Effect Damage: Accidents, such as a ball striking the window or hailstorms, can trigger cracks.
  • Age and Wear: Over time, the materials in windows can break down, making them more susceptible to breaking.
  • Poor Installation: Improperly installed windows can establish fractures due to irregular pressure or poor sealing.

Determining the Type of Crack

Before trying any repair, it’s vital to recognize the type of fracture:

  1. Hairline Cracks: These are great, often hardly visible fractures that do not usually reach the edges of the window.
  2. Tension Cracks: These are typically bigger and can range from one edge of the window to another.
  3. Bull’s Eye Cracks: These are circular fractures that take place from a direct effect.
  4. Star Cracks: These are multiple cracks radiating from a single point of effect.

Tools and Materials Needed

  • Epoxy Resin: For small fractures, epoxy resin can be used to fill the spaces.
  • Clear Silicone Sealant: This can be used to seal the edges and avoid water seepage.
  • Screwdriver and Pliers: Useful for removing old glazing and hardware.
  • Scraping Tool: For removing old putty or caulk.
  • Masking Tape: To protect the surrounding area from adhesive.
  • Security Gear: Gloves, security goggles, and a dust mask are necessary.

Step-by-Step Guide to Repairing Minor Cracks

  1. Clean the Area:

    • Use a mild detergent and water to clean the window and the surrounding area.
    • Dry the surface thoroughly with a tidy cloth or towel.
  2. Apply Masking Tape:

    • Place masking tape on both sides of the crack to avoid the epoxy from spreading.
  3. Prepare the Epoxy Resin:

    • Follow the maker’s directions to mix the epoxy resin.
    • Ensure the resin is smooth and totally free of lumps.
  4. Inject the Epoxy:

    • Use a syringe or a similar tool to inject the epoxy into the crack.
    • Work from one end to the other, ensuring the fracture is completely filled.
  5. Smooth the Surface:

    • Use a plastic scraper or a putty knife to smooth the epoxy over the fracture.
    • Eliminate excess epoxy to attain a flush surface area.
  6. Allow to Cure:

    • Let the epoxy remedy according to the manufacturer’s directions, usually 24-48 hours.
    • Prevent touching or applying pressure to the area during this time.
  7. Remove the Tape:

    • Carefully remove the masking tape to expose the fixed location.
  8. Apply Clear Silicone Sealant:

    • Apply a thin layer of clear silicone sealant around the edges of the window to ensure a watertight seal.

Expert Repair for Major Cracks

For major cracks, such as those that jeopardize the structural stability of the window, it is recommended to seek expert help. Here are the actions an expert might follow:

  1. Assess the Damage:

    • An expert will assess the degree of the damage and identify if the window can be fixed or needs to be replaced.
  2. Remove the Damaged Glass:

    • Using specific tools, the specialist will thoroughly eliminate the broken window repair glass to avoid additional damage to the frame.
  3. Prepare the Frame:

    • The frame will be cleaned and any old putty or caulk will be gotten rid of.
  4. Install New Glass:

    • A new piece of glass will be cut to fit the window frame and installed utilizing glazing substance or new putty.
  5. Seal and Finish:

    • The professional will apply a new seal around the edges and finish the repair to ensure it is both practical and visually pleasing.

Avoiding Future Cracks

Prevention is essential to maintaining the stability of your windows. Here are some pointers:

  • Regular Maintenance: Check your windows annually for indications of wear or damage.
  • Proper Installation: Ensure that brand-new windows are set up properly to avoid uneven pressure.
  • Usage Tempered Glass: Tempered glass is more powerful and more resistant to cracks than regular glass.
  • Protect from Elements: Use window coverings or awnings to protect windows from direct sunshine and harsh weather.
